  • Abstract
    A circular microstrip patch antenna is designed and analyzed. Concentric vias are inserted into the patch, as a method for improving the antenna parameters, mainly admittance of the patch antenna. The various effects of increasing the number of vias are studied and analyzed - using FEKO software. The advantage of a circular patch over rectangular patch is that it has more directivity. An optimization technique is then proposed for the design of a circular microstrip antenna. The designed circular patch antenna is optimized using Particle Swarm Optimization, a technique that can find out the optimized value of the design parameters for a desired resonant frequency.
